ISDN PRI T1, chief…

Assuming no NFAS, D channels are:
1 span = 24
2 span = 48
3 span = 72
4 span = 96

FYI Rowell, there’s not enough info there to go on. It could be a large number of things (cabling, configuration, sun-spots) and it’s not possible to troubleshoot without additional information. Basically, it’s telling you that span 4 configured (‘Provisioned’) but not working properly (‘In Alarm, Down’).

I would first suspect the cable. Most of the time you will use a T1 cross over cable. Pin outs can be found here:
